EXPLANATORY NOTE

(This note is not part of the Regulations)


    
1. These Regulations amend the Work at Height Regulations (Northern Ireland) 2005 (S.R. 2005 No. 279) ("the principal Regulations") which give effect as respects Northern Ireland to Directive 2001/45/EC of the European Parliament and of the Council (O.J. No. L195, 19.7.2001, p. 46), amending Council Directive 89/655/EEC (O.J. No. L393, 30.12.89, p. 13) concerning the minimum safety and health requirements for the use of work equipment by workers at work. The principal Regulations contain additional provisions, including additional provisions which replace Regulations giving effect to certain provisions of Council Directives 89/654/EEC (O.J. No. L393, 30.12.89, p. 1) concerning the minimum safety and health requirements for the workplace and 92/57/EEC (O.J. No. L245, 26.8.92, p.6) on the implementation of minimum safety and health requirements at temporary or mobile construction sites.

    
2. These Regulations omit the disapplication in regulation 3(4)(d) of the principal Regulations in relation to work concerning the provision of instruction or leadership to one or more persons in connection with their engagement in caving or climbing by way of sport, recreation, team building or similar activities (regulation 2(2)). These Regulations also make provision as to what is taken to be compliance with certain requirements under the principal Regulations as they apply to such work (regulation 2(3)).

    
3. In Great Britain the corresponding Regulations are the Work at Height (Amendment) Regulations 2007 (S.I. 2007/114). The Great Britain Health and Safety Executive has prepared a regulatory impact assessment in respect of those Regulations and a copy of that assessment together with a Northern Ireland Supplement prepared by the Health and Safety Executive for Northern Ireland is held at the offices of that Executive at 83 Ladas Drive, Belfast, BT6 9FR from where a copy may be obtained on request.
